AAA Omaha (29-12): W 7-4
The best record in MiLB will stay in Omaha for at least another day. Emmanuel Rivera continues to be an absolute terror for opposing pitchers. He finished Sunday’s game 3-4 with HR #13 and 2B #10, pushing his season average to .303 and his OPS to .980. Remember, he started the year 1-16 so he’s really had to get hot to get his season OPS anywhere near 1.000. Ryan McBroom hit HR #14 in last night’s victory. Nick Dini and Angelo Castellano tabbed a pair of hits each. Daniel Lynch allowed 9 hits in 4 IP, but struck out 4 and only allowed 2 ER. Grant Gavin did not allow an ER in 3 innings of relief. Richard Lovelady and Tyler Zuber each threw a perfect inning to close things out. Omaha heads to Des Moines this Tuesday.
AA Northwest Arkansas (19-20): W 8-2
Nick Pratto hit his AA (yes, all AA leagues) leading 12th HR in yesterday’s victory (BWJ technically still has 11). MJ Melendez smacked his 4th double. Brewer Hicklen hit his 5th double. Bobby Witt Jr. finished 2-4 with a walk and 2 stolen bases. Jon Heasley threw 5 innings of 1-run ball. Northwest Arkansas will return home on Tuesday after a two-week road trip looking to get back to .500 as they host the Arkansas Travelers.
Both Quad Cities (A+) and Columbia (A-) were rained out yesterday. Quad Cities will hit the road starting Tuesday night in Beloit, Wisconsin, and Columbia will be at home for a 6-game series.
